Catch Me by Lisa Gardner

and yet another great thriller from one of the consumate thriller writers.
This entry is all about Charlene aka Charlie, a radio dispatcher for a police department who works the graveyard shift. She is convinced someone is out to kill her and basis this assumption on the fact that her two best friends were murdered a year apart on the same day.
Charlie lives in fear and has equipped herself with a gun and practices at the local shooting range on a regular basis. In addition, she has taken up boxing and tries to keep herself in great physical shape. She decides to enlist the aid of D.D. Warren, Gardners popular character to help her.
A fast-paced thriller that will string you along wanting to discover who's after Charlie. My only complaint about the story was in regard to the unveiling of the person who is trying to kill Charlie. I thought the author could have placed more clues in the story to lead up to the climax of the book.
